金佰旭 一、定义与职责 什么是软件开发?简单来说,软件开发是指通过一系列流程和技术手段来
首页 » 行业资讯 » 文章详情

一、定义与职责

什么是软件开发?简单来说,软件开发是指通过一系列流程和技术手段来设计、编码和测试计算机程序的过程。这包括需求分析、系统设计、代码编写、单元测试等多个阶段。

二、步骤解析

    • 需求收集与分析:了解客户具体需求,明确软件的功能、性能指标等。

    • 设计规划:根据需求制定详细的设计方案,包括数据库设计、模块划分等。

    • 编码实现:按照设计方案进行代码编写,并遵循良好的编程规范和标准。

    • 测试验证:通过各种测试手段确保软件的质量与稳定性,及时发现并修复问题。

    • 部署上线与维护更新:将开发完成的软件发布到实际运行环境,并根据用户反馈不断优化完善。

三、挑战与机遇

软件开发面临着诸多技术难题,如性能优化、安全性保障等。但同时,随着云计算、人工智能等新兴技术的发展,也为开发者带来了更多创新可能。

未来趋势如何?尽管存在不确定性,但可以预见的是,敏捷开发、DevOps文化将成为主流方向,推动行业向更加高效灵活的方向发展。

总结:

软件开发不仅是一项技术活儿,更是一门艺术。它要求从业者具备扎实的专业技能以及敏锐的洞察力和创造力。希望每位开发者都能在这个充满挑战与机遇的时代里找到属于自己的舞台!

免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。

相关文章

« 上一篇:软件开发是做什么的?让我们一起深入了解这一行业。 下一篇:软件开发是做什么的?探秘幕后技术 »